Output ab888d95df69293593b70313f90e06069bae01de4212b66c40aef71cf8eaa306:13

value
7211512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26878ba2784be69ff10abf855c7086af1aab96a0 OP_EQUAL
address
35CjyhL3QCbxMMtVwmxiJWbiU9dBDAYm5R
transaction
ab888d95df69293593b70313f90e06069bae01de4212b66c40aef71cf8eaa306
spent
true